IP查询
查询
你查询的IP:[122.51.201.217] 地理位置:中国–上海–上海
最新查询
117.59.62.119
117.124.126.63
210.76.83.208
60.200.147.132
219.216.3.9
123.4.19.194
122.4.106.146
123.244.255.21
117.24.87.250
122.51.201.217
202.85.208.47
60.232.229.114
123.177.173.2
123.64.213.169
211.144.128.135
218.77.133.191
116.242.238.109
123.180.120.111
202.43.144.193
203.191.144.222
120.64.154.154
119.75.208.158
221.198.114.200
202.90.224.220
125.96.35.17
202.136.208.66
121.58.144.3
58.68.128.9
114.28.141.185
167.139.183.19
119.232.197.217